APK文件的组成内容是什么?
你是否好奇手机上一个应用或游戏的构成要素是什么?其实,了解应用开发复杂内在机制的关键就在于APK文件——那么让我们更详细地了解一下吧!
什么是APK?
从根本上说,APK是用于在安卓设备上分发和安装应用和游戏的文件格式。这个类型的文件包含所有必要的组件,以确保你的应用或游戏正常运行,包括原始代码文件、图像、视频和其他媒体以及任何其他所需资源。
APK文件中包含什么?
一般而言,APK文件由四个主要组件组成:活动、服务、广播接收器和内容提供者。这些组件各有其用途,但在应用的运作方式中都扮演着重要角色。例如,"活动"组件控制用户界面,而"服务"组件包含执行后台任务的代码。
APK的结构与内容是什么?
一旦你了解了APK中包含的内容,了解其结构也很有帮助。一般来说,结构相对简单,可以分为两个主要部分。根目录是初始路径,包含如证书和权限文件夹等资源。第二部分是子目录,包含包的主要内容,包括AndroidManifest.xml、活动、布局和其他重要文件。
提取和查看APK内容的步骤是什么?
如果你是一名开发者,对幕后工作感兴趣,提取和查看APK文件的内容相对简单。你所需要做的就是在设备上下载一个文件管理器应用,定位文件并点击开始解压缩过程。解压完成后,你可以使用文件管理器应用查看包的内容。你也可以在AndroidFreeware上使用其他文件管理器应用。
总的来说,APK文件是开发Android应用和游戏的重要组成部分。了解四个主要组件和包的结构可以提供有助于理解应用或游戏如何工作和运行的见解。提取和查看APK内容是窥探你最喜欢的应用和游戏内部工作原理的好方法。